Familiarize your self with native laws and regulations related to alcohol service. This contains age verification, understanding limits, and recognizing signs of intoxication to prevent overservice. Hosts who start their shifts throughout opening hours often arrive before the bar’s official open time. This early arrival allows them to prepare the venue for the day, which includes organizing seating preparations, establishing reservation systems, and ensuring the cleanliness of the entrance and host station.
